    Mrs. Nelvena Wyvonia Richardson (Simpson)

    August 16, 1940 - February 22, 2018

    Nelvena was born Friday, August 16, 1940 in Seneca, South Carolina, daughter of Addis Simpson and Bessie Mae Simpson (Williams). She retired from the New Cumberland Army Depot as a Computer Analyst. Nelvena was a faithful member of United House of Prayer for All People, and she loved to travel, sing and play the piano. A resident of Harrisburg, PA, for many years, Nelvena and her family relocated to Tampa, Florida. On Thursday, February 22, 2018, at her home in Tampa, at seventy-seven years of age, Nelvena entered into eternal rest joining in eternal life her parents, Addis and Bessie Simpson, her brothers, Larry “Fuzzo” Simpson, Edgar Simpson, Odell R. Simpson, and her granddaughter, Bre`Anna Keller. She leaves to share treasured memories her husband, Floyd S. Richardson Sr. of Tampa, FL; two sons, Waymond Richardson of West Palm Beach, FL, and Floyd (Lesa) Richardson Jr. of Newport News, VA; two daughters, Vennicee (Talmas) Washington-Wanamaker and Tamara Richardson of Tampa; one brother, Darrell Simpson of Chicago, IL; three sisters, Vennicee Brice, Jeanette (Steve) Pearson and Nannette Swanson, all of Harrisburg, PA; as well as numerous grandchildren, great-grandchildren, n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ends.
